Violations found and a warning issued, with a return visit required. 6 recorded, 2 high priority.
Show 6 findings ▾
Raw animal foods not properly separated from each other in holding unit based upon minimum required cooking temperature. On a rack in the walk-in raw ground beef is stored over raw whole muscle beef and raw shrimp, raw chicken is stored over raw pork ribs. Operator moved items to proper storage order.
Vacuum breaker missing at mop sink faucet or on fitting/splitter added to mop sink faucet. There is no vacuum breaker on the splitter attached to the mop sink faucet.
No proof of required state approved employee training provided for any employees. To order approved program food safety material, call DBPR contracted provider: Florida Restaurant and Lodging Association (SafeStaff) 866-372-7233.
Raw/undercooked animal food offered and establishment has no written consumer advisory. Raw animal foods must be fully cooked prior to service. Inspector provided the operator with a consumer advisory which the operator hung on the wall at the host stand.
Spray bottle containing toxic substance not labeled. There is a unlabeled chemical spray bottle in the triple sink. Operator labeled the spray bottle.
Ice scoop handle in contact with ice. The ice scoop at the bar has the handle in contact with the ice. Inspector educated the bartender on how to properly store the ice scoop.
Met inspection standards. 3 violations recorded, none serious enough to require a return visit.
Show 3 findings ▾
Raw animal foods not properly separated from each other in holding unit based upon minimum required cooking temperature. On a rolling rack in the walk-in cooler raw poultry is stored over raw shrimp and raw fish. Operator moved items to proper storage order.
Handwash sink not accessible for employee use at all times. The hand sink next to the triple sink is blocked by a bin of dirty linens. Operator moved the bin of linens.
In-use tongs stored on equipment door handle between uses. There are multiple sets of tongs hanging from the oven door handle. Operator removed the tongs.
